  • Meru County is located on the Eastern side of the Mt Kenya covering 6,936 square kilometers. It is strategically placed bordering Isiolo County to the North, Tharaka County to the South West, Nyeri County to the South West and Laikipia County to the West. The county has a population of 1,356,301 million people. Our vision is green united prosperous model ...

    Chairperson

    Overall duties and responsibilities of the Board.

    • Establish and abolish offices in the County Public Service;
    • Appoint persons to or act in office of The County Public Service, including on the Boards of urban areas within the County and to confirm appointments;
    • Exercise disciplinary control over and remove persons holding or acting in offices of the County Public Service;
    • Prepare regular reports for submission to the County Assembly and the Governor on the execution of the functions of the Board;
    • Promote in the County Public Service the values and principles referred to in article 10 and 232 of the Constitution of Kenya;
    • Evaluate and report to the County Assembly on the extent to which the values and principles referred to in Article 10 and 232 of the Constitution of Kenya are complied with in the County Public Service;
    • Facilitate the development of coherent, integrated Human Resource Planning and Budgeting for personnel emolument in the County;
    • Advise the County Government on Human Resource Planning Management and Development;
    • Advise the County Government on implementation and monitoring of the National Performance Management system in the County;
    • Advise the County Government on all policies, procedures and reports on Public Service;
    • Support the development and operationalization of County Public Service Code of Conduct; and
    • Make recommendations to the Salaries and Remunerations Commission (SRC) on behalf of the County Government, on the remuneration, pensions and gratuities for County Public Service employees.
    • Perform any other duties as assigned.

    Additional duties and responsibilities

    • The chairperson will be in-charge of Meru County Public Service Board andw shall: -
      • Chair the Board meetings;
      • Provide strategic leadership and policy direction to the Board; and
      • Maintain effective collaboration and partnership with other organs of National and County Governments.
